How to Reach Lembeek in Belgium

Lembeek is a charming town located in the Flemish Brabant province of Belgium. If you are planning a visit to this picturesque destination, there are several transportation options available to reach Lembeek.

By Air:

The nearest international airport to Lembeek is Brussels Airport, which is approximately 35 kilometers away. From the airport, you can hire a taxi or take a train to Lembeek. The train journey takes around 30 minutes, and there are regular connections available.

By Train:

Lembeek has its own train station, making it easily accessible by rail. If you are traveling from Brussels, you can take a direct train to Lembeek, which usually takes around 20 minutes. There are also train connections available from other major cities in Belgium.

By Car:

If you prefer to drive, Lembeek is conveniently located near major highways. From Brussels, you can take the E19/A7 motorway and exit at Lembeek. The town is well-connected by road, and there are parking facilities available for visitors.

By Public Transport:

Lembeek is well-served by public transport, making it easy to reach from various locations in Belgium. Bus services operate regularly to and from Lembeek, connecting it to nearby towns and cities. You can check the local transport schedules for the most up-to-date information.

By Bicycle:

Belgium is known for its cycling culture, and Lembeek is no exception. If you enjoy cycling, you can explore the beautiful countryside and reach Lembeek by bike. There are dedicated cycling paths and routes that connect the town to neighboring areas.

No matter which mode of transportation you choose, reaching Lembeek is relatively straightforward. Once you arrive, you can immerse yourself in the town's rich history, visit its historic landmarks, and enjoy the warm hospitality of its residents.

Getting to know Lembeek, Belgium

Lembeek is a charming village located in the Flemish Brabant province of Belgium. Situated in the municipality of Halle, it is a historic community with a rich cultural heritage and picturesque surroundings.

Nestled amidst rolling green fields and scenic landscapes, Lembeek offers a peaceful and idyllic setting. The village is known for its quaint cobblestone streets, traditional houses, and well-preserved historical buildings. Its central square, surrounded by local shops, cafes, and restaurants, provides a warm and inviting atmosphere for both residents and visitors.

One of the notable landmarks in Lembeek is the St. Remigius Church, a stunning example of Gothic architecture. Dating back to the 13th century, the church is renowned for its beautiful stained glass windows and intricate stone carvings.

Lembeek is also an ideal destination for nature lovers and outdoor enthusiasts. The village is surrounded by lush countryside and offers a variety of walking and cycling trails. Additionally, the nearby Senne River provides opportunities for boating, fishing, and other water activities.

Furthermore, Lembeek hosts several annual events and celebrations that showcase its vibrant community spirit. The Lembeekse Feesten, a traditional festival held in August, attracts locals and tourists alike with its live music, food stalls, and cultural performances.

For those interested in history and heritage, Lembeek has a small museum dedicated to preserving the village's past. The museum exhibits artifacts and documents that offer insights into the local history and traditions.

In conclusion, Lembeek combines the charm of a small, traditional Belgian village with its scenic beauty, historical sites, and cultural events. Whether you are looking for a relaxing getaway or a glimpse into the region's heritage, Lembeek offers a delightful experience for all.
